linux怎么加装nodejs
Linux系统下加装Node.js是一项对于开发者来说十分重要的操作。在当今数字化的时代,Node.js凭借其高效的事件驱动、非阻塞I/O模型,在服务器端开发领域发挥着关键作用。它能够帮助开发者更轻松地构建高性能、可扩展的网络应用程序。对于使用Linux系统的用户而言,掌握如何在该系统上成功加装Node.js,将为其开发工作带来极大的便利,开启更多可能。
要确定你所使用的Linux系统版本。不同版本在加装步骤上可能会稍有差异,但大致的流程是相似的。一般来说,我们可以通过终端命令来查看系统版本。常见的Linux发行版如Ubuntu、CentOS等都有各自对应的加装方式。
以Ubuntu系统为例,我们可以先打开终端。在终端中,我们需要更新软件包列表,这一步骤至关重要,它能确保我们获取到最新的软件信息。通过输入“sudo apt-get update”命令,系统会自动从软件源中下载最新的软件包索引。更新完成后,我们就可以准备安装Node.js了。
接下来,我们可以使用官方提供的安装脚本。在Node.js的官方网站上,有针对不同操作系统的安装指导。对于Ubuntu系统,我们可以在终端中输入“cur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ash -”。这里的“14.x”代表Node.js的版本号,你可以根据自己的需求选择合适的版本。这条命令会下载并执行Node.js的安装脚本,它会自动配置好系统的软件源,以便后续能够顺利安装Node.js。
执行完上述命令后,我们就可以正式安装Node.js了。在终端中输入“sudo apt-get install -y nodejs”,系统会开始下载并安装Node.js及其相关的依赖包。安装过程中,系统会提示输入密码,这是为了获取管理员权限来执行安装操作。等待安装完成即可。
安装完成后,我们可以通过一些简单的命令来验证Node.js是否安装成功。在终端中输入“node -v”,如果显示出当前安装的Node.js版本号,那就说明安装成功了。例如,可能会显示“v14.17.0”这样的版本信息。同样,输入“npm -v”可以查看npm(Node.js的包管理工具)的版本号。
除了上述通过官方脚本安装的方式,还有其他一些途径可以安装Node.js。比如,我们可以从系统的软件包管理器中直接安装。在某些Linux发行版中,可能已经将Node.js打包好了,我们可以直接通过软件包管理器进行安装。但这种方式可能存在版本不够新的问题。
对于一些追求极致性能和定制化的用户,也可以选择从源代码编译安装Node.js。这种方式虽然相对复杂一些,但可以根据自己的需求进行定制化配置。从源代码编译安装需要先下载Node.js的源代码包,然后按照官方的编译指导进行一系列的操作步骤,包括配置编译选项、执行编译命令等。不过,这种方式一般适用于有一定技术经验的开发者,普通用户如果只是日常使用,通过官方脚本安装就足够了。
在安装过程中,可能会遇到一些问题。比如,如果在更新软件包列表时出现网络问题,可能会导致下载失败。这时,我们需要检查网络连接是否正常,可以尝试更换网络环境或者检查防火墙设置。如果在安装Node.js时出现依赖包冲突的问题,系统会提示相关信息。我们可以根据提示来解决冲突,可能需要手动卸载一些不兼容的软件包,或者调整安装顺序。
成功安装Node.js后,我们就可以利用它来进行各种开发工作了。可以使用Node.js创建Web服务器,搭建自己的网站或者应用程序接口。通过npm,我们可以方便地管理项目的依赖包,安装各种工具和库来扩展项目的功能。例如,我们可以使用Express框架来快速搭建一个Web应用,通过输入“npm install express”命令,就可以将Express框架安装到项目中,然后就可以利用它来构建路由、处理请求等操作。
在Linux系统上加装Node.js是一个相对简单但又十分重要的操作。通过正确的步骤,我们能够顺利安装并使用Node.js,为我们的开发工作提供强大的支持,让我们能够在Linux环境下更高效地构建各种优秀的应用程序。无论是小型的个人项目还是大型的企业级应用,Node.js都能发挥出它的优势,助力开发者实现自己的目标。
<< 上一篇
下一篇 >>
网友留言(0 条)